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to identify the source and extent of the problem.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ify areas that need attention. From there, we’ll develop a customized plan to address the damage and prevent further problems.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from your property. This may involve using wet vacuums, pumps, or other machinery to remove standing water and reduce the risk of further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After water extraction, we’ll focus on drying and dehumidifying your property. This involves using spec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ces, preventing further damage and promoting a healthy environment.

Step 4: Restoration and Repair

Finally, we’ll focus on restoring and repairing your property to its original condition. This may involve replacing damaged materials, repairing structural damage, and addressing any other issues that arose during the mitigation process.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Mitigation

Don’t wait until it’s too late!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ture or m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to investigate further.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age. Check for signs of warping, buckling, or discoloration, especially around sinks, toilets, and appliances.

Stains or Water Spots on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ains or spots on walls and ceilings can be a sign of hidden water damage. Check for signs of discoloration or staining, especially around windows, doors, and plumbing fixtures.

Unexplained Puddles or Leaks

Unexplained puddles or leaks can be a sign of a more serious problem. Check for signs of water damage, especially around appliances, sinks, and toilets.

Increased Humidity or Mold Growth

Increased humidity or mold growth can be a sign of hidden moisture. Check for signs of mold growth, especially in areas with poor ventilation or high humidity.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a bathroom Yes No You can likely fix the leak y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ge and tools.
Standing water in a basement No Yes Standing water can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and other serious problems that need professional attention.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Burst pipes can cause extensive damage and need specialized equipment to extract water and dry out the area.
Water stains on a ceiling No Yes Water stains can be a sign of hidden water damage that needs professional attention to prevent further problems.
Musty odors in a crawl space No Yes Musty odors can be a sign of mold growth or hidden moisture that needs professional attention to resolve.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in Wiggins, MS

The cost of water damage mitigation can vary widely dep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as local conditions in Wiggins, MS. Here are some estimated price ranges for common water damage mitigation services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of moisture, and equipment needed
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or costs
Emergency Response $1,000 – $5,000 Time of day,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Mold Remediation $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age to give you a more accurate quote.
